Stay in a piece of Kansas City history! Nestled in the vibrant Crossroads Art District, the historic No. 8 Hose and Reel Firehouse is the city's oldest standing fire station. r>Downtown is Kansas City’s busy business and culture hub, with a vibrant waterfront shopping and dining area at River Market. The striking, shell-shaped Kauffman Center showcases symphony, opera, and ballet, while grand Union Station, from 1914, includes a planetarium. Penn Valley Park offers skyline views and contains the National WWI Museum and Memorial. Other museums trace Negro Leagues baseball and American jazz.

This firehouse was originally built in 1885, which was 17 years after K.C.F.D. had its commencement in 1868. The firehouse was fully renovated in 2021 by a world famous interior designer and architect, Kennedy Van Trump, from Columbia University. The downstairs has also been converted into a charity to support firefighters across the city!
